Some small changes from the last, recent update that can significantly decrease network delays in some circumstances: "Major bugfixes: - When a tunneled directory request is made to a directory server that's down, notice after 30 seconds rather than 120 seconds. Also, fail any begindir streams that are pending on it, so they can retry elsewhere. This was causing multi-minute delays on bootstrap." Fix: Patch attached with submission follows:
